CNC machine controller is a control system used in computer numerical control (CNC) machines to manage and execute various operations such as cutting, drilling, and milling. It reads the program from a CNC machine programming language, executes it based on the program, and monitors the operation progress.
Where To Use Cnc Machine Controller
CNC machine controllers are widely used in various industries such as aerospace, automotive, medical equipment, and consumer goods manufacturing for precision machining, cutting, drilling, and milling operations.

How To Use Cnc Machine Controller
Connect the CNC machine controller to the CNC machine and power supply
Load the CNC program into the controller's memory through a programming language or user interface
Configure the controller settings according to the specific machining requirements
Start the machining operation by sending the control signal from the controller to the CNC machine
Monitor and adjust the operation as needed during the process
